Quoting IT: Content management systems and hype
"We frequently counsel customers not to default to SharePoint (or Google, Oracle, IBM, et. al.) just because there's a lot of awareness of that package in the marketplace. Awareness is a marketing concept that cannot convey how a product will fit for you, architecturally, functionally, and financially."
-Tony Byrne, Analyst, CMS Watch, "Is Drupal Over-hyped?", June 11, 2009.
